Buying Guide for Best Shocks For Honda Pilot

Shocks are an important part of any vehicle, and they work to ensure a smooth ride. When it comes to choosing the best shocks for your Honda Pilot, there are a few things you’ll want to keep in mind. First, consider the terrain you’ll be driving on most often. If you live in a city and do mostly stop-and-go driving, then your needs will be different than someone who primarily drives on off-road or unpaved roads.

Next, think about what type of driving you typically do. Are you looking for a smooth ride for long highway trips? Or do you need something that can handle sharp turns and quick stops? There are different types of shocks available that cater to different driving styles, so be sure to choose accordingly.

Finally, don’t forget to factor in cost when making your decision. Shocks can range significantly in price, so be sure to set a budget before beginning your search. With these factors in mind, you’re well on your way to finding the best shocks for your Honda Pilot!
